프로그래밍 QnA

bbcworldservice의 이미지

Shared Library 관련 질문.

머리가 나빠서 그런지 구글링을 해도 모르겠네요.

당연한 질문일 수도 있는데..

A.so 라는 공유 라이브러리를

process 1 와
process 2 에서 각각 load 하여 쓸 때,

당연히 두 프로세스는 각기 다른 메모리 영역에 A.so 를 load해서 쓰는 것이고,
각각 A.so 안의 내용에 접근 할 때, 서로 간의 영향은 전혀 없는게 맞는 것인지 궁금합니다...

livey의 이미지

설치 없이 php python javascript 스크립트로 활용 방법 문의

윈도우와 리눅스 맥os 등에서 php python javascript 등의 스크립트 언어를
설치스크립트로 활용한다거나 간단한 프로그램 만들때 사용하려고 합니다.
컴퓨터에 해당 스크립트 언어의 설치 여부와 상관없이
스크립트를 실행시켜줄 php.exe python.exe javascript.exe 같은 파일들을 포함시켜서 사용하고싶은데
이런 스크립트 엔진 모듈은 어디서 찾을수 있는지 어떻게 사용하는지 좀 궁금합니다. (__)

momark의 이미지

MFC시리얼통신 포인터 질문

제가 시리얼통신을 공부하고있는데 포트와 보레이트를 입력하는 구간을 다른 새창의 다이얼로그에 두고 작업을 했습니다. 다름이 아니라 CmdTaget을 상속받은 comm이라는 클래스를 새창 다이얼로그에 포인터로 넣었는데요 새창에서는 포인터에 입력한 변수들이 다 잘 들어가있고 작동도 잘됩니다. 근데 메인 다이얼로그에 똑같이 comm을 포인터로 추가하고 send를 보내려고 포인터를 사용하면 변수에 식을계산할수없다 또는 쓰레기값이 들어가있는데 제가 새창과 메인창이 CDialogEx를 상속받고있는데 같은 상속을 받고있으면 포인터를 양쪽에 못쓰나요? 아니라면 문제를 잘 모르겠네요;; 도와주세요

bluesolip의 이미지

linux watchdog 처리 문의

안녕하세요

application 구현중에 있습니다.
다음과 같이 코드 내에서 reboot을 시키는데 watchdog을 실행시켜 reboot되는지를 감독하고 싶습니다.
system("reboot");

어떻게 처리해야 하는지요?
고수님들의 의견부탁드립니다.

jgttl의 이미지

java 배운지 딱 5일째...

프로그래밍 공부를 시작한지 딱 5일 되어가네요...

뭔가 하나 만들어보고 싶어 이책 저책 뒤적뒤적하다 만들었는데요

왜 실행이 안 되는지...궁금하네요

고수님들의 조언이 필요할 것 같아서요 ^^;

그리고 아주 간단하게 구현이 될 것 같은데

왜 이리 길게 한 것인지 짧은 지식으로 힘드네요

한번 봐 주시겠어요? 시간외 수당을 구하는 것인데요 5일동안 시작시간과 종료시간을 넣으면 자동적으로 계산되어 나오는 구조입니다.

adiyoung의 이미지

안드로이드에 터치IC 드라이버 포팅 후 마우스처럼? 인식되는 현상

안녕하세요

임베디드리눅스도 처음이고 안드로이드도 직접적으로 개발하는게 처음이다보니까
개념자체가 제대로 안잡혀있고 터치드라이버 포팅도 겨우 한 수준이다보니 모르는게 너무많네요..

일단 안드로이드 4.3에 TSC2007 터치ic를 올렸습니다
커널단에서 좌표값을 제대로 찍어주는것까지 확인했습니다
x, y 좌표의 최대값은 4096인것 같구요
LCD는 해상도가 800*480입니다
그렇다면 드라이버에서 report할 때 값을 800*480에 맞게 수정해서 리포트하면 되는게 맞는건가요?

그리고 첨부파일처럼 포인터가 동그랗게 하나가 생겨있습니다
예를들어 (x:100,y:200) 만큼 드래그했다고 하면, 제가 처음 누른 부분에서부터 100,200을 이동한게 아니라
마우스 포인터마냥 현재찍혀있는 동그라미포인터위치에서부터 100,200만큼 이동이 됩니다
위에서 말씀드렸든 드라이버 개념이 좀 부족하다보니 이게 커널의 문제인지 안드로이드의 문제인지 구분도 잘 안되고 원인을 모르겠네요
도움 주시면 감사하겠습니다

cjm9236의 이미지

하이브리드앱과 네이티브앱 실질적인 차이를 잘 모르겠습니다..

뭐 하이브리드앱은 웹앱과 네이티브앱의 조합이니 이런 말을 하는데,
둘의 차이에 대해서 이론적인 이야기는 많이 들어 알고 있습니다.
가령, 하드웨어 접근성이나 속도, 개발 유지보수 비용의 차이 등... 이론적인 설명은 너무 잘 아는데,

정확하게 어떨때에 하이브리드앱으로 만들어야 하고 어떨때에 네이티브앱을 만들어야 하는지 잘모르겠네요.
아직 개발 초기 단계라서 너무 모르는게 많긴 한데,

저는 서비스를 위한 어플리케이션을 만들거고, 네트워크 기술이라고 해봤자 제 생각에
웹서버에 있는 데이터베이스에서 내용을 긁어오고, 작은 알고리즘을 통해서 그 내용들을 가공하는 식의
작동을 할것 같은데 굳이 하이브리드 앱으로 만들필요가 있는지 궁금하네요.

제 생각엔 분명히 기본 안드로이드 내에서 그런 부분을 충분히 다 해결할 수 있다고 생각이 들거든요...

뭐 어쨋든 사설이 너무 길었는데, 간단하게 질문을 요약하자면,

ljh30633의 이미지

fopen이나 open함수로 읽은 파일의 파일명을 확인할 수 있는방법

fopen 함수로 으로 파일위치를 넣고 FILE포인터를 얻고
open함수로 파일 디스크립터를 얻는 걸로 알고 있습니다.

이 FILE포인터 또는 디스크립터로 읽은 파일명을 알아 낼수 있는 방법이 있나요 혹시?

jsyong91의 이미지

자바에서 정교한 시간 타이머가 필요합니다

자바, 안드로이드 환경에서 마이크로초 단위의 timestamp가 필요합니다.

현재 시간을 받아올 필요는 없고 elapsed time, 즉 시간 간격을 알 수만 있으면 되는데 방법을 찾기가 힘드네요.

자바에서 지원해주는 System.nanoTime()은 너무 해상도가 떨어지는 것 같고, 구글링을 해본 결과 HRTimer? 를 사용하라고 하는 것 같은데 JNI를 사용해야 하나요?

혹시 방법을 알고 계시면 알려주시면 감사하겠습니다.

annilove1의 이미지

질문이요! 어셈블리 조건분기

첨부파일에 보시면
36p에

부호 있음과 부호 없음이 있는데요

cmp vleft, vright

여기서

vleft와 vright가 동시에 부호 있으면 왼쪽 표를 쓰고

vleft와 vright가 동시에 부호가 없으면 오른쪽 표를 쓰는건가요

그 어떤수가 부호가 있고 없고는
프로그래머에 달려있는데

아 갑자기
부호 있고 없고가 멘붕이네요
아 갑자기 생각해낸건데
둘중 하나라도 '-' 기호가 붙어있으면 왼쪽 표를 쓰고
둘다 양수 + 면 오른쪽을 쓴다는건가요

페이지

프로그래밍 QnA 구독하기